Job description

As a Project Support & Events Coordinator you hold a central position in the Business Analytics and Strategy (BAS) department of IQVIA Belgium. You will be sharing your time between the MTOUCH team (a division of BAS) and the BAS team.  Within MTOUCH, you are responsible for the coordination and execution of different types of events in the medical-pharmaceutical sector, both live and online. For BAS, you will be involved in several administrative and logistics tasks to support the smooth progress of the projects.

Our customers are pharmaceutical companies, scientific associations and interest groups active in the health care sector in the Benelux; our target group are mainly health care professionals. The Business Analytics and Strategy division is part of the international IQVIA group.

Task package

  • You support the MTOUCH Event Manager in the organization of webinars, e-learning, round table discussions and scientific symposia, in terms of planning, logistics, communication, recruitment.
  • You oversee the MTOUCH administration, such as preparation of activity report, satisfaction surveys, supplier quotations, maintenance of department repository, planning update, newsletters, etc.
  • You are coordinating and supporting in the communication with the suppliers and in communicating across channels on MTOUCH activities.
  • You are regularly present at the events that are organized by MTOUCH.
  • You are supporting the Business Analytics team with survey answers encoding, coordination of 3rd parties for translations and printing & handling of surveys, engagement with physicians that participated to our market research and follow up on their payments, maintenance of databases, etc.
  • You support the Business Analytics team in the organization of their internal and external events.
  • By maintaining a high level of quality and respecting deadlines, you focus on long-term customer relationships with us.

Your profile

  • You have +/- 2 years’ experience in event coordination or in an assistant role including operational and administrative tasks.
  • You have excellent organizational and communication skills.
  • You are proactive, positive, enthusiastic, and able to work under pressure.
  • Your administrative preparation and follow-up of events and admin tasks is outstanding, and you have a hands-on attitude.
  • You are energized by customer satisfaction; you are open-minded and creative.
  • You are a team player, and you are not afraid to take initiative.
  • You are fluent in Dutch, French and English.
  • You have excellent knowledge of MS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ook)
  • You have a tech savviness. If you master Adobe Creative Suit solutions, this is an extra asset.
  • You have a driver's license.
